1. Why do drivers drive their car slowly during rainy days?
A. Drivers drive slowly because the windshield is blurred.
B. Drivers drive slowly because they are afraid of the rain
C. Drivers drive slowly because the road is wet so there is less friction.
D. Drivers drive slowly because the road is wet so there is more friction.
2.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
2. Which is NOT a way of reducing friction?
A. applying lubricant
B. putting spikes on tires
C. making the floor smooth
D. putting grease on bicycle gears
3.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
45 sec • 1 pt
3. Why do you need to put rollers under the cabinets when you want to move them?
A. to apply more force
B. to stop the movement of the cabinet
C. to slow down the movement of the cabinet
D. to minimize friction through the small surface of contact of the rollers.
4.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
45 sec • 1 pt
4. Why do badminton players use rubber shoes while playing?
A. to slide since the badminton court is slippery
B. to glide faster since the badminton court is slippery
C. to have lesser friction between their shoes and the floor.
D. to have greater friction between their shoes and the floor.
5.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
45 sec • 1 pt
5. Which of the following situations shows that friction is increased?
A. Ana uses rubber shoes while jogging.
B. Ruben puts rollers on heavy cabinets.
C. Naldo puts grease on his bicycle gears.
D. Belle puts floor wax to make the floor smooth.
6.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
45 sec • 1 pt
6. In which of the following situations would friction most likely pose a problem?
A. holding a pen to write
B. striking a match to cook
C. walking on a slippery floor
D. rubbing your hands to warm them
7.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
45 sec • 1 pt
7. Which of the following shows that friction could be harmful?
A. writing on the board
B. holding a piece of paper
C. tearing out of bicycle gears
D. using breaks when stopping
